/** backup firestore to storage */
export const backupFirestore = async (jobData: JobModel): Promise<any> => {
    console.log('backupFirestore is started');
 
    const auth = new GoogleAuth({
        scopes: [
            'https://www.googleapis.com/auth/datastore',
            'https://www.googleapis.com/auth/cloud-platform'
        ]
    });
    const client = await auth.getClient();
    const projectId = process.env.GCLOUD_PROJECT;
    const bucketName = `${projectId}.appspot.com`;
    const backupFileName = new Date().toISOString();
    const backupUrl = `gs://${bucketName}/backups/firestore/${backupFileName}.json`;
    const user = await auth.getCredentials();
 
    return client.request({
        url: `https://firestore.googleapis.com/v1beta1/projects/${projectId}/databases/(default):exportDocuments`,
        method: 'POST',
        data: {outputUriPrefix: backupUrl}
    })
        .then(() =>
            Promise.resolve({backupUrl})
        ).catch(reason => {
            console.error(`
---------------------------------------------------------
Please consider to check permissions of service accounts.
---------------------------------------------------------
https://console.cloud.google.com/iam-admin/iam
- Give "Cloud Datastore Import Export Admin" and "Editor" roles to
-   "${projectId}@appspot.gserviceaccount.com"
-   "${user.client_email}"
---------------------------------------------------------
Please consider to check if backup directory is already exist.
---------------------------------------------------------
gs://${bucketName}/backups/firestore/
---------------------------------------------------------
`);
            throw reason;
        });
 
};
